Winner, Tripp County will have a presence at Pheasant Fest

By Dan Bechtold, Editor

The Winner area will be well represented at Pheasant Fest in Sioux Falls Feb. 16, 17 and 18. The event will be held at the Denny Sanford Premier Center and the Sioux Falls Convention Center.

This is the first time this national convention has been held in South Dakota.

The Winner Area Chamber of Commerce will have a booth with executive director Karla Brozik welcoming guests and handing out material on hunting in the Winner area.

There will be several people helping Brozik in the booth and a few of those who will be helping will be Jack Burns, Wendy Mortenson, Chandra Cudmore, Susan Cable and Barry and Betty Tideman.

The Chamber will be giving away shot glasses, cards, koozies and pheasant pins. In addition, they will be handing out the latest edition of the travelers guide.

Other Tripp County area exhibitors will be local chapter of Pheasants Forever, Lazy Z Grand Lodge, HH Game Birds, Pheasants on the Prairie.

Runnings will be one of the exhibitors and Russ Temple of the Winner store will be working in the Runnings booth.
Loretta (Meyer) Furry, formerly of Winner, will have a booth called fall feathers.

Mike Scott, president of the local chapter of Pheasants Forever, says this is the first time the local chapter has had a booth at Pheasant Fest.

“We really encourage people to come out for a day. If you like the outdoors and hunting you will enjoy it,” said Scott.
